Journal: Journal of Orthopaedic Surgery and Research
Article Title: Recruitment of Brd3 and Brd4 to acetylated chromatin is essential for proinflammatory cytokine-induced matrix-degrading enzyme expression
doi: 10.1186/s13018-019-1091-3
Figure Lengend Snippet: The recruitment of Brd3 and Brd4 to the chromatin responsible for IL-1β- or TNF-α-induced transcription. a – d Human chondrocytes were pretreated with or without I-BET151 (1 μM), followed by addition of vehicle, IL-1β (10 ng/ml) or TNF-α (10 ng/ml) for 6 h, and ChIP assays were performed for Brd3. e – h Human chondrocytes were pretreated with or without I-BET151 (1 μM), followed by addition of vehicle, IL-1β (10 ng/ml) or TNF-α (10 ng/ml) for 6 h, and ChIP assays were performed for Brd4. The quantitative analysis of targeted promoter regions was determined by real-time PCR using specific primers for MMP1 , MMP3 , MMP13 , and ADAMTS4. Relative fold-change values were calculated in comparison with the vehicle control that was set to 1 ( n = 2)
